MEL MACOUN

Pain PHYSIOTHERAPIST

Bachelor of Physiotherapy, Master of Musculoskeletal Physiotherapy

Mel's areas of interest are:

Chronic Pain Physiotherapy

Mel has been with TM Physio since 2016, having enjoyed a career in both public and private settings. Through her studies of her Master of Musculoskeletal Physiotherapy, attained in 2009, she developed her skills and knowledge for private practice physio, in parallel with her specialised training in the field of Pain Physiotherapy. 

After evolving her practice to serve people with persistent, recurrent, complex and chronic pain complaints, Mel went on to qualify as a Nutrition, Health and Wellness Coach in 2023. Preferring an educational and coaching approach to recovery, she then “retired her hands” and now consults for TM Physio for specific cases that would benefit from her extensive expertise in the chronic pain area.
